Kyari Yates is a scholar working on Pollution, Health, Toxicology and Mutagenesis and Ocean Engineering. According to data from OpenAlex, Kyari Yates has authored 33 papers receiving a total of 526 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Pollution, 9 papers in Health, Toxicology and Mutagenesis and 9 papers in Ocean Engineering. Recurrent topics in Kyari Yates’s work include Drilling and Well Engineering (8 papers), Pharmaceutical and Antibiotic Environmental Impacts (6 papers) and Toxic Organic Pollutants Impact (6 papers). Kyari Yates is often cited by papers focused on Drilling and Well Engineering (8 papers), Pharmaceutical and Antibiotic Environmental Impacts (6 papers) and Toxic Organic Pollutants Impact (6 papers). Kyari Yates collaborates with scholars based in United Kingdom, China and South Africa. Kyari Yates's co-authors include Colin F. Moffat, Lynda Webster, James Njuguna, Pat Pollard, Zulin Zhang, Mark Osprey, Ian M. Davies, Rupert Hough, Bruce Petrie and Craig McKenzie and has published in prestigious journals such as The Science of The Total Environment, Food Chemistry and Environmental Pollution.
